繁体   English   中英

如何让我的图像在我的本地主机(WAMP)中打开

[英]How do I get my image to open in my localhost (WAMP)

我正在处理一个 index.php 文件,该文件保存在 Wamp 上的 htdocs 文件夹中的 6-php 文件夹中。 我正在尝试制作整页背景图片。 我从 unsplash 下载了一张图片并将其保存为 background.jpg 在 Wamp 上的 6-php 文件夹中。 当我试图让图像显示在http://localhost/6-php/index.php/ 中时,它没有打开。 文字显示,只是图像没有打开。 当我将它作为http://localhost/6-php/打开时,图像显示但是当我添加 /index.php/ 时,图片消失了,只显示文本。

我尝试从不同的站点下载不同的图像。 我试过将它保存在不同的文件夹中。

html { 
      background-image: url(background.jpg) no-repeat center center fixed; 
      -webkit-background-size: cover;
      -moz-background-size: cover;
      -o-background-size: cover;
      background-size: cover;
    }

我也只试过<img src="background.jpg">没有结果。

我希望“background.jpg”成为我的 index.php 文件中的整页背景图片。

图像的路径很重要。 有2个optins提及图片的路径

path of image htdocs/project/images/background.jpg path of css htdocs/project/css/style.css path of index.php htdocs/project/index.php

  1. 图像的相对路径路径从尝试访问该文件的基础文件开始

    style.css

    body { background-image: url('../images/background.jpg') }

    index.php

    <img src="../images/background.jpg">

  2. 绝对路径

    图像的路径从htdocs文件夹开始

    style.css

    body { background-image: url('/project/images/background.jpg') }

    index.php

    <img src="/project/images/background.jpg">

 html { background-image: url(background.jpg); -webkit-background-size: cover; -moz-background-size: cover; -o-background-size: cover; background-size: cover; } 
 <!DOCTYPE html> <html> <head> <link rel="stylesheet" type="text/css" href="style.css"> </head> <body> </body> </html> 

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M